"A man’s wit can be judged better by his questions than by his answers." ~~ Mishle Yehoshua
"Respect an old man who has lost his learning: remember that the fragments of the Tablets broken by Moses were preserved alongside the new." ~~ Talmud: Berakot 8b
"When you are asked a question and do not know what to answer, be not ashamed to say: “I know not!”" ~~ Mivchar Hapeninim
"Arrange the ordinances in order, like a set table." ~~ Akiba, Mekilta
"Who withholds a law from his pupil robs him of his inheritance." ~~ Rab (Abba Arika)
"A teacher should give his pupil opportunity for independent practice without suggestions from himself, and thus set upon him the stamp of indelible memory in its purest form." ~~ Philo
"No learning, no manners; no manners, no learning; no lore, no loaf." ~~ Avot 3:17
"A man may learn for seventy years and at the end die a fool." ~~ Yiddish Proverb
"If you see cities uprooted, know that it came about because they did not maintain teachers’ salaries." ~~ Simeon b. Yohai
"Jerusalem was destroyed just because school-children were kept from their classrooms." ~~ Talmud, Shabbat
"The prevailing pilosophy of education tends to discredit hard work." ~~ Abraham Flexner
"Moses ordained that Jews be addressed each holiday on the subject of that holiday, and he said to Israel: if you do this, it will be as if you established God’s sovereignty." ~~ Midrash Abkir, Yalkut Shimoni #408
